CSM MEN'S AND WOMEN'S SWIMMING DEFEATS METRO STATE

GOLDEN, Colo. - The Colorado School of Mines men's and women's swimming and diving teams were in action Saturday afternoon against Metro State. The CSM men defeated the Roadrunners, 153-75, while the Oredigger women picked up a 118-92 victory.

Junior National Qualifier Travis Kummer (Erie, Colo./Niwot) led the men as he won the 100 Freestyle (50.84) and also had the best time in the 100 Fly (55.27) in an exhibition swim. He also placed second in the 100 Back (56.71).

On the women's side, freshman Jane Muldoon (Montrose, Colo./Montrose) picked up wins in the 100 Back (1:09.26) and the 100 Free (1:00.35) and also placed second in the 200 IM (2:40.34).

Both teams will return to action next Saturday when they host Colorado College at 1:00 pm.
